The development of nanoscience and technology has devoted significant attention to studies on hollow particles. Among these materials, mesoporous silica nanoparticles have recently attracted attention as potential nanocontainers due to their high stability, biocompatibility, large surface area, controllable pore diameter and easy surface functionalization. Mesoporous silica nanoparticles can uptake, store and release organic or inorganic molecules of various sizes, shapes and functionalities.
